软件定制开发

软件开发外包 全栈软件开发:从后端到前端的全方位技能培养

发布日期:2025-04-21 10:09    点击次数:184

  

随着互联网技术的飞速发展,软件开发行业对人才的需求也在不断增长。在这个过程中,“全栈”这一概念逐渐成为炙手可热的话题。那么,什么是全栈软件开发?它又为何如此重要?本文将为您详细解析全栈软件开发的核心理念,并探讨如何通过系统化的学习实现从后端到前端的全方位技能培养。

## 什么是全栈软件开发?

全栈软件开发是指开发者具备前后端开发能力,能够独立完成整个软件项目的设计、编码、测试和部署等环节的工作。一个合格的全栈工程师不仅需要掌握数据库管理、服务器配置等后端技术,还需要精通HTML、CSS、JavaScript等前端框架,以及相关工具链的应用。这种多面手式的技术能力使得全栈工程师能够在团队协作中发挥更大的作用,同时也能显著提高项目的开发效率。

## 全栈软件开发的重要性

在当今数字化转型的大背景下,企业对于高效能团队的需求愈发强烈。传统的分工模式往往导致开发周期长、沟通成本高,而全栈软件开发则打破了这一瓶颈。通过培养具备全面技能的人才,企业可以更快地响应市场需求变化,推出更具竞争力的产品和服务。此外,全栈工程师还能够在技术选型上提供更灵活的选择,为项目带来更多的创新可能性。

## 如何进行全栈软件开发的学习?

要成为一名优秀的全栈软件开发人员,长沙软件开发、软件开发公司、软件开发、企业软件开发、管理软件开发、APP软件开发、小程序开发、应用系统开发、外包开发、开发公司、长沙软件开发公司、长沙APP开发公司首先需要明确自己的学习路径。以下是几个关键步骤:

1. **打牢基础**:无论是前端还是后端,扎实的基础知识都是不可或缺的。建议初学者从HTML、CSS、JavaScript开始,逐步深入学习Node.js、Python或Java等后端语言。

2. **实践为主**:理论固然重要,但实际操作才是检验真理的标准。可以通过参与开源项目、搭建个人博客等方式积累实战经验,提升解决问题的能力。

3. **工具与框架**:熟练掌握Git版本控制工具、Docker容器化技术以及React、Vue等主流前端框架,可以帮助你更高效地完成开发任务。

4. **持续学习**:技术更新迭代速度快,保持好奇心和求知欲是每个程序员必备的品质。定期关注行业动态,参加线上线下的技术交流活动,有助于拓宽视野并发现新的成长机会。

## 结语

全栈软件开发不仅仅是一种职业技能,更是未来职业发展的趋势所在。通过科学规划的学习路径,我们可以轻松实现从后端到前端的全方位技能培养。我们相信,在不久的将来,每一位热爱编程的朋友都能够凭借自身的努力,在这个充满机遇与挑战的时代里找到属于自己的位置!

(注:文中“全栈软件开发”出现次数约为总字数的2%软件开发外包,符合SEO优化要求)



Powered by 软件开发公司-软件定制开发-软件开发-云迈科技 @2013-2022 RSS地图 HTML地图

Copyright Powered by365站群 © 2013-2025 云迈科技 版权所有